South Yorkshire’s ZOO Digital narrows pretax losses and CEO praises 'positive momentum'

Sheffield cloud-based media production firm ZOO Digital has reported narrowed pretax losses for the 6 months to September 31, recording losses of £638k compared to the same period last year, when losses reached £773k.

Revenue did increase to £6.9 million from £4.7 million

Stuart Green, CEO of ZOO Digital, commented,“The Board is very pleased with the progress achieved in the period. The positive momentum from the prior year has continued into the first half, resulting in top line revenue growth of over 40%.

“We remain encouraged by the increasing demand we are receiving for our cloud-based solutions, and our ZOOsubs offering in particular is attracting considerable interest.

“While we continue to monitor closely the changing dynamics within the entertainment industry, the growing base of repeatable revenues combined with a pipeline of new clients and projects, with a balance sheet strengthened after the period end, gives the Board good grounds for optimism in the future prospects of the business.”
